The closing date for the nationwide DStv Film Talent Celebration short film competition is 29 February. Films have to be between three and 10 minutes in length and can be in any genre as long as the entry is a high impact offering.
This competition focuses on the ability of South African filmmakers to tell wonderful authentic stories through very short films.

Winners will receive cash prizes which they can add to their funds to tell more beautiful South African stories. The Best Overall Production will win R50k, while Best Director, Best Editor, Best Cinematographer and Best Sound will each win R40k. The Best Newcomer will win R20K.

The only accepted format is DVD and all submissions must include a completed entry form. There is no entry fee.

The competition will culminate in a special event during which the winners will be announced and the top short films screened. DStv will also take this opportunity to recognise the up-and-coming filmmakers from DStv’s Film Skills Development programme.
